Pricing and Cost

By this point, you should know that Omaze is a for-profit company. Each donation given will fund their campaigns and prizes.

Only a tiny percentage of this money is actually donated to charity. 60% percent of this is given to fundraisers if a celebrity is involved in the campaign. Expect different prices if no celebrity is present. Here is the estimated breakdown in the table below.

Donation Funnel Prize based experience Celebrity experience
Donation by the user $10 $10
Expenses $7 $2.50
Omaze’s profit $1.50 $1.50
Charity $1.50 $6

 

So, in the end, they do help, except that they need compensation to make it work for both sides.

What is Omaze?

Omaze, a for-profit organization that raises money for charity, offers sweepstakes and prizes. It was founded in 2012 by Ryan Cummins and Matthew Pohlson.

It came to existence in one charity auction they attended one day. They used the existing model as a basis to create a more seamless platform for charities. Their aim is to donate money in kind to all charities they’ve partnered up with. Any amount will do since it will be given to those in need.
